Solutions Incorporated Hours of Operation and Locations in Los Alamos, NM
- 1 Locations in Los Alamos
- www.fastwastesolution.com
- Solutions Incorporated Hours
- Category: Electronics
-
167 Maple DrView Store Details
(505) 662-2261